Duncan Taylor's The Octave range showcases whisky that has spent years ageing in octave casks, which are approximately 1/8th the size of a butt and yield around 80 bottles. That means these cask-strength whiskies have had some of the most intense, lengthy sherry maturation on the market with a limited number available. In the case of this Glentauchers 26 Year Old from 1996, it was bottled at a natural cask strength 51.7% ABV, with a total outturn of only 58 bottles.
